New York, June 3 (Petra) — U.S. stock indexes fell on Wednesday,
while U.S. crude oil prices rose, with West Texas Intermediate crude
reaching $96.31 per barrel.
The Dow Jones Industrial Average dropped 620 points, or 1.21%, to
50,687.
The technology-heavy Nasdaq index fell 240 points to 26,854, while
the Standard & Poor’s 500 Index (S&P 500) declined by about 56 points
to 7,553.
